		<content:encoded><![CDATA[<p>One way to reduce wear on your expensive small-base dies is to use a dedicated separate decapping die.</p>
<p>This keeps primer &#8220;grit&#8221; well away from resizing dies. The really dedicated can use this die in an old &#8220;loose&#8221; press (not TOO loose) so that any crud that falls out does not accumulate in your &#8220;good&#8217; press frame, ram and lever pivots.</p>
<p>Once the &#8220;raw&#8221; brass is deprimed, washed and dried, de-crimp the primer pockets. I am a big fan of the Dillon 600 for robustness and repeatability.</p>
<p>FLS and then check overall length. Brass that has expanded more in firing (sloppy &#8220;mi-spec&#8221; chambers and headspace , especially in SAWs, mean that expansion has to go somewhere during resizing, and it goes FORWARD. ALWAYS gauge OAL.</p>
<p>Trim to the desired length (Powered trimmers are a godsend)</p>
<p>Inside and outside chamfer as desired and THEN do the pin-polish thing. Finally, rinse in distilled water to remove chemical residues, shake off the excess water and sun or LOW oven dry..</p>
<p>A lot of &#8220;drama&#8221;? Yes. However you will have quality brass that will handle a fair bit of re-use (especially if you anneal after every few cycles). And keep checking OAL and trimming accordingly.</p>
<p>The pressures that can develop with over-length brass in &#8220;match&#8221; chambers can disassemble your rifle with nary a screwdriver or pin-punch in sight.</p>
